Cardiac Glycosides and sodium/potassium-ATPase,e and their receptor. Inhibition of this enzyme by cardiac glycosides leads for instance in the heart to a decrease or a delay in membrane sodium/potassium- ion transport, and indirectly to an increase in the intracellular ionized calcium-concentration and an increase in cardiac contractile force.
